Best Traditional Sports Game on GameCube, Nominees
 
 
One of the most enduring genres in gaming is the traditional sports game--just as real-world professional sports will continue to be immensely popular for the foreseeable future, so too will computer simulations of these events. Significant advances in sports gaming are made each year, as these games continue to be refined in how they look, play, and sound. The following five games are the nominees for Best Traditional Sports Game on GameCube:
